The Electromagnetic Spectrum Worksheet



#### 1. Labeling the Electromagnetic Spectrum and Filling in Blanks

The electromagnetic spectrum is a continuous range of wavelengths, frequencies, and energies. The spectrum is typically ordered from shortest to longest wavelength (or highest to lowest frequency). Here’s how to label the spectrum and fill in the blanks:

---

#### Step 1: Label the Wavelengths
- The electromagnetic spectrum ranges from Gamma Rays (shortest wavelength) on the left to Radio Waves (longest wavelength) on the right.
- The visible light region is in the middle, with colors ranging from violet to red.

#### Step 2: Fill in the Blanks
- The words "shorter" and "higher" are associated with shorter wavelengths and higher frequencies (left side of the spectrum).
- The words "longer" and "lower" are associated with longer wavelengths and lower frequencies (right side of the spectrum).

#### Completed Labels:
- From left to right:
- Gamma Ray
- X-ray
- Ultraviolet
- Visible (violet → red)
- Infrared
- Microwave
- Radio

- For the blanks:
- Shorter wavelengths → Higher energy
- Longer wavelengths → Lower energy

---

#### Diagram Explanation:
1. Wavelength: Increases from left to right.
- Gamma rays have the shortest wavelength.
- Radio waves have the longest wavelength.
2. Frequency: Decreases from left to right.
- Gamma rays have the highest frequency.
- Radio waves have the lowest frequency.
3. Energy: Decreases from left to right.
- Gamma rays have the highest energy.
- Radio waves have the lowest energy.

#### 2. Which Part of the Electromagnetic Spectrum:

Now, let’s match each description to the appropriate part of the electromagnetic spectrum:

---

#### a. Has the largest waves
- Radio Waves: These have the longest wavelengths in the electromagnetic spectrum.

---

#### b. Is the most dangerous
- Gamma Rays: Gamma rays have the highest energy and are highly penetrating, making them the most dangerous to living organisms.

---

#### c. Is used for warming the skin
- Infrared Radiation: Infrared radiation is absorbed by the skin and converted into heat, which is why it is used for warming.

---

#### d. Is used to see broken bones
- X-rays: X-rays can penetrate soft tissues but not bones, making them useful for imaging broken bones.

---

#### e. Are used in cellphones and radar
- Microwaves: Microwaves are used in communication technologies like cellphones and radar systems.

---

#### f. Helps the skin to make vitamin D
- Ultraviolet (UV) Light: UV light from the sun helps the skin produce vitamin D when exposed in moderation.

---

#### g. Is used to see
- Visible Light: This is the portion of the electromagnetic spectrum that our eyes can detect, allowing us to see.
